Hey, quick note for release managers: the Bramblequeue broker upgrade is mostly painless. Drain the consumers, bump the version on each node, and watch the dashboard until the lag graph flattens. One gotcha — the config vault relocks itself after every upgrade, so you'll need to reopen it with the recovery passphrase below.

strongbox words: fraath-isteth

## GPU Memory Profiling — VramScope

Quick intro for you as the incoming release manager: VramScope is our in-house tool for tracking GPU memory allocations across the Hollybrook training cluster. Releases go out roughly every six weeks, built by the Kestrel pipeline and published to the internal tool registry. Nothing ships unsigned — downstream installers hard-fail otherwise, which has saved us more than once. For signing release artifacts, use the deploy key below.

signing key of bagap-yawep = bky13_TbfT6ZMUoGJo2

New to the Pixelgrove team? Our first big win was fixing a memory leak in the Snapcrate image cache — evicted thumbnails kept a decoder handle alive. The fix lives in the cache-core module. To access the staging diagnostics vault where the leak traces are archived, use the passphrase below.

unlock words, hahip-baduf: holwyn-istath-julvan